Born: 21 April 1760 in Les Éboulements, Canada

Paternal grandparents: Jean TREMBLAY , Catherine LAVOIE
Maternal grandparents: Étienne TREMBLAY , Marie-Louise BONNEAU


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Joseph-Marie  married  Josephte-Esther SAVARD 5 February 1787 in Isle-aux-Coudres, Province of Québec, Canada .  The couple had (at least) 3 children.
Josephte-Esther SAVARD  was born 4 October 1762 in Isle-aux-Coudres, Québec, Canada (Saint-Louis-de-l'Isle-aux-Coudres).  Josephte-Esther was the child of Pierre SAVARD and Marguerite BRISSON.

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
